Launched in early 2015, Pro-Ject’s 2 Xperience SB design proved to be very popular (we reviewed the DC version in HFC 397 and gave it five stars). Now comesthe 2 Xperience SB S-Shape (above). The £1,299 turntable has the same features as its predecessor, but adds an s-shaped tonearm made from an aluminium alloy with high internal damping properties and a detachable headshell. A wide variety of Pro-Ject and Ortofon headshells are said to be compatible.

Following the release of it'sRPM 9 Carbonturntable, Pro-Ject has now unveiled its top-of-the-range RPM 10 Carbon. The company describes the new vinyl spinner as being created to "give vinyl fans something that not only delivers high-end sound, but that also stands apart as an outstanding object of desire". And so consequently it boasts the same tear drop design as its predecessor (the RPM 10. 1 Evolution) and the aforementioned RPM 9 Carbon.

Pure has announced the launch of the Highway 400 and 600 plug-and-play in-car digital audio entertainment adapters that give users access to a whole world of content. The new adapters are designed to sit on the dashboard to give the driver access to digital radio and Spotify, while Bluetooth allows for streaming from suitably equipped mobile phones. Additional features include Music Disovery and Voice Activation. Music Discovery is particularly useful if you're listening to the radio and a tune comes on that you like.

Pure has announced details of its new line of digital and internet radios with Bluetooth connectivity. The new line up includes: theEvoke F3digital and internet radio with Bluetooth and Spotify Connect; the third generation of the One Mini, Midi and Maxi digital radiosand theEvoke C series – a range of all-in-one home audio systems. The Evoke F3 (pictured above) is a compact digital and internet table-top radio with with instant access to over 25,000 stations worldwide. It offersBluetooth connectivity and also has Spotify Connect for simple music streaming.

Purehas announced a new collaboration with the leading British fabric and wallpaper manufacturer Sanderson that will see its radios produced with floral prints. Pure's Evoke Mio D2 and D4 (above) digital radios are now available to buy in Sanderson’s “Chelsea” and “DandelionClocks” prints. The range will be available exclusively through John Lewisfor £149. 99 and £199.
